Q: Is 612,066,050 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 612,066,050 is not a prime number.

Why is 612,066,050 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 612066050 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 25 50 379 758 1,895 3,790 9,475 18,950 32,299 64,598 161,495 322,990 807,475 1,614,950 12,241,321 24,482,642 61,206,605 122,413,210 306,033,025 and 612,066,050, with no remainder.

Since 612,066,050 cannot be divided by just 1 and 612,066,050, it is not a prime number.
